【Caixin Global】 XPeng’s self-developed “Turing” chip has seen its application scope further expanded. On the evening of April 2, XPeng (NYSE: XPEV / 09868.HK), through its mass-market model MONA M03, launched a revised version. Among the mid- and high-trim versions equipped with intelligent driver-assistance capabilities, the computing-power chip is switched from NVIDIA solutions to the company’s in-house self-developed solution.

MONA M03 was released in August 2024, targeting the 110,000 to 150,000 yuan price range. After the model went on sale, it received strong feedback, and it has been the biggest “contributor” in helping XPeng move out of its slump that began in the second half of that year. The company previously disclosed in October 2025 that 14 months after M03’s launch, cumulative sales surpassed 200,000 units.
